What affects the price

Wildlife removal costs depend on a few key variables. We look at the specific animal species, the size of your property, and how long the infestation has been active. The complexity of the entry points—and whether they require structural repairs to prevent re-entry—also changes the total. If we need to set up multi-day trapping programs or perform sanitation work in tight crawlspaces, those factors add to the bottom line.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Summer heat drives animals to look for cool, dark spaces. They often find their way under porches, sheds, or into crawlspaces where the temperature is more stable. Young animals are also becoming more mobile this time of year, which can lead to accidental entry into homes. When should I call for non-emergency animal control in Spokane?

You should call for non-emergency animal control in Spokane, Washington, when you notice signs of wildlife activity but there's no immediate danger. This includes hearing noises in your attic, finding droppings, or seeing evidence of chewing. If you see an animal that appears injured but is not aggressive, it's also a non-emergency. These pros can schedule a visit to assess and resolve the situation. Same-day appointments are often available in Spokane.

What is involved in emergency animal control in Spokane?

Emergency animal control in Spokane, Washington, is for situations where an animal poses an immediate threat to human safety or health. This could be an aggressive animal trapped inside your home or an animal suspected of having rabies. For less urgent issues, like routine attic intrusions, a standard service call is appropriate.
